How to Choose the Right Ayurvedic Cough Syrup?
Ayurvedic cough syrups are made with natural herbs, but not every syrup works the same way. The best one for you depends on the kind of cough you have and what your body needs. Here’s how to choose the right one:
Identify Your Cough Type
- Dry Cough: No mucus, often caused by throat irritation, pollution, or viral infections.
- Look for ingredients like Tulsi (Holy Basil), Mulethi (Liquorice), and Honey to soothe the throat.
- Wet or Productive Cough: Involves mucus or chest congestion.
- Choose syrups with Vasaka (Adhatoda vasica), Pippali (Long Pepper), and Ginger to help loosen and expel mucus.
- Allergic or Seasonal Cough: Triggered by allergens like dust or pollen.
- Opt for anti-inflammatory herbs such as Kantakari, Somlata, and Peppermint to ease breathing.
- Understand the Role of Key Herbs
- Tulsi (Holy Basil): Boosts immunity and supports respiratory health.
- Mulethi (Liquorice): Soothes a sore throat and reduces inflammation.
- Vasaka (Adhatoda vasica): Helps clear mucus; natural expectorant.
- Ginger (Adrak): Eases throat irritation and supports digestion.
- Pippali (Long Pepper): Opens airways and improves herb absorption.
- Honey: Coats the throat, suppresses cough, and has a mild antibacterial effect.
- Consider Your Lifestyle and Health Needs
- Choose non-drowsy formulas if you need to stay alert during the day.
- Go for sugar-free options if you have diabetes or are watching your sugar intake.
- Select alcohol-free syrups if you're pregnant, elderly, or giving it to children.
- Check Brand Quality and Certifications
- Look for syrups from trusted Ayurvedic brands.
- Ensure the product is AYUSH-certified and manufactured under GMP (Good Manufacturing Practices) standards for safety and quality.
- Consult a Healthcare Professional if Needed
- If your cough lasts more than 7–10 days.
- If you have underlying conditions like asthma, GERD, or chronic bronchitis.
- If you're unsure which syrup is right for your symptoms.
How to Use Ayurvedic Cough Syrups for Adults?
To get the most benefit from Ayurvedic cough syrups, it’s important to use them correctly and consistently. Here’s how:
1.Follow the Recommended Dosage
- Most Ayurvedic cough syrups recommend 1 to 2 teaspoons (5–10 ml) per dose.
- Take it 2 to 3 times a day, usually after meals.
- Always read the label or consult an Ayurvedic practitioner for exact dosage, especially if you're taking other medications.
2.Shake the Bottle Before Use: Herbal ingredients can settle at the bottom. Shake the bottle well to ensure the active herbs are distributed evenly.
3.Use a Clean Measuring Spoon or Cap: Avoid guessing the amount. Use a proper measuring spoon or the cap provided to take the correct dose.
4.Avoid Eating or Drinking Immediately After: Wait at least 15 to 20 minutes after taking the syrup before eating or drinking. This helps the herbs absorb better and work more effectively.
5.Store Properly: Keep the syrup in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ight. Always close the cap tightly after use.
6.Be Consistent: Herbal remedies often work best when taken regularly over a few days. Don’t skip doses if you want steady relief.
7.Know When to Stop: If your cough lasts more than 7 to 10 days or worsens, consult a doctor. Ayurvedic syrups are supportive, but persistent symptoms may need further evaluation.
